Ritthem, Netherlands

Ritthem is a small village located in the municipality of Vlissingen in the province of Zeeland, Netherlands. It is situated near the Western Scheldt River and is known for its picturesque landscapes and natural beauty.

One of the main attractions of Ritthem is Fort Rammekens, which is the oldest sea fort in Western Europe. Built in the 16th century, this historic fort played a significant role in defending the region from invasions. Today, it serves as a popular tourist spot with guided tours and exhibitions that showcase its rich history.

Ritthem is also a popular destination for nature enthusiasts. The village is surrounded by beautiful dunes, marshes, and wildlife reserves that offer plenty of opportunities for hiking, cycling, and birdwatching. The nearby Ritthemse Creek is home to various species of birds, making it a paradise for bird lovers.
